随着移动互联网的普及,用户访问网站的设备种类日益多样化,从大屏幕的PC显示器到小巧的智能手机,网站内容的显示效果直接关系到用户体验和信息的有效传递。安企CMS(AnQiCMS)深谙此道,提供了多种设备适配模式,旨在帮助用户灵活地优化内容显示,确保网站在任何设备上都能呈现出**状态。

安企CMS的设备适配策略主要分为三种,每种模式都有其独特的实现方式和适用场景,让网站运营者可以根据自身需求和技术能力,选择最契合的解决方案。

响应式设计(自适应模式)

首先,安企CMS支持响应式设计,也就是文档中提及的“自适应模式”。这是一种当前最常采用的网页设计策略之一。在这种模式下,您的网站使用一套统一的模板代码。这套代码通过CSS(层叠样式表)等技术,智能识别用户设备的屏幕尺寸、分辨率和方向,并自动调整页面的布局、图片大小和字体等元素,以确保内容在不同设备上都能清晰、美观地展现。

选择自适应模式的优势在于其简洁性SEO友好性。您只需开发和维护一套模板,大大降低了开发成本和后期的维护复杂度。对于搜索引擎而言,单一的URL结构也更易于抓取和索引,避免了重复内容的问题,有利于网站的整体SEO表现。用户无论通过何种设备访问,都始终指向同一个网址,提升了用户体验的一致性。

代码适配模式

其次是代码适配模式。这种模式介于完全自适应和完全独立站点之间,它允许网站在同一个URL下,根据不同的用户代理(User-Agent)或其他设备识别方式,动态地提供针对不同设备优化的模板内容。例如,当用户通过手机访问时,系统会加载一套专门为手机设计的模板;而当通过PC访问时,则加载PC模板。

安企CMS在实现代码适配时,要求您在模板目录下创建一个名为 mobile/ 的子目录,并将为移动设备设计的模板文件存放在其中。通过在模板的 config.json 文件中将 template_type 设置为 1 来启用此模式。这种方式的好处是,您可以在保持URL统一的前提下,为不同设备提供更定制化的体验,比如移动端可以省略一些不必要的元素,或者重新组织布局以适应触控操作。这为那些希望在移动端提供更精细化控制,同时又不想牺牲SEO(因为URL保持不变)的网站提供了理想选择。

PC+手机独立站点模式

最后,对于追求极致分离和特定体验的网站,安企CMS提供了PC+手机独立站点模式。顾名思义,这种模式下PC端和移动端被视为两个相对独立的网站,它们通常拥有独立的域名(例如,PC端是 www.example.com,移动端是 m.example.com),以及完全独立的模板和内容呈现逻辑。

在安企CMS中,启用独立站点模式也需要您创建 mobile/ 目录来存放移动端模板,并需要在 config.json 中将 template_type 设置为 2。更重要的是,您需要在系统设置中明确配置移动端地址。这种模式的优点在于能够为PC和移动用户提供完全定制、互不干扰的独立体验,从而实现对性能和用户交互的极致优化。例如,您可以为移动端站点设计完全不同的导航结构、功能模块,甚至可以针对移动用户的特定行为模式进行内容编排。然而,这也意味着更高的开发和维护成本,因为您实质上在运营和管理两个网站。在SEO方面,也需要通过正确的设置(如使用 rel="alternate"rel="canonical" 标签)来明确两个站点之间的关系,以避免搜索引擎混淆。

无论您选择哪种适配模式,安企CMS都提供了灵活的配置选项和强大的模板引擎支持,让网站运营者能够根据实际业务需求,轻松实现内容的跨设备优化展示。这不仅提升了用户在不同设备上的访问体验,也为网站的长期发展和搜索引擎表现奠定了坚实的基础。

常见问题 (FAQ)

  1. 如何选择适合自己网站的设备适配模式? 选择模式主要取决于您的预算、技术能力和对用户体验的定制需求。如果希望快速上线、维护成本低且对定制化要求不高,响应式设计是**选择;如果需要在统一URL下为移动端提供更独特的体验,但又不想完全重构,代码适配模式会更合适;而如果您有足够的资源,追求PC和移动端极致的用户体验和性能,且不介意更高的维护成本,那么PC+手机独立站点模式将提供最大自由度。

  2. 采用代码适配或PC+手机独立站点模式时,移动端模板如何组织? 无论选择代码适配还是PC+手机独立站点模式,安企CMS都要求您在当前使用的模板主题目录下创建一个名为 mobile/ 的子目录。所有针对移动设备设计的模板文件,例如移动端首页、文章详情页、分类列表页等,都应放置在该 mobile/ 目录中,以便系统正确识别并加载。

  3. PC+手机独立站点模式下,是否需要为移动端设置单独的域名? 是的,当您选择PC+手机独立站点模式时,通常会为移动端设置一个独立的域名,例如 m.您的域名.com。这需要在您的域名服务商处进行解析配置,并在安企CMS的系统设置中填入这个移动端地址。虽然技术上也可以使用子目录或二级域名,但在独立站点模式下,单独的移动端域名能更好地体现其独立性,并便于后期针对移动端的运营和分析。